소스 검색

WebGLRenderer: No need to create location yet.

Mr.doob 11 년 전
부모
커밋
d8bdd5f122
1개의 변경된 파일1개의 추가작업 그리고 2개의 파일을 삭제
  1. 1 2
      src/renderers/WebGLRenderer.js

+ 1 - 2
src/renderers/WebGLRenderer.js

@@ -4832,8 +4832,6 @@ THREE.WebGLRenderer = function ( parameters ) {
 
 		for ( var j = 0, jl = uniforms.length; j < jl; j ++ ) {
 
-			var location = uniforms[ j ][ 1 ];
-
 			var uniform = uniforms[ j ][ 0 ];
 
 			// needsUpdate property is not added to all uniforms.
@@ -4841,6 +4839,7 @@ THREE.WebGLRenderer = function ( parameters ) {
 
 			var type = uniform.type;
 			var value = uniform.value;
+			var location = uniforms[ j ][ 1 ];
 
 			switch ( type ) {